Rosita's Al Pastor

Why Rosita's Al Pastor is a fun option when searching for things to do near me with friends and family
Rosita's Al Pastor, located at 1801 East Riverside Drive in Austin, TX, is a beloved Mexican food truck and counter-service restaurant known for its authentic and flavorful offerings. Established in 1985 by Rosa Juarez, Rosita's has garnered a reputation for serving some of the best tacos al pastor and other Tex-Mex staples in Austin. What makes Rosita's a fantastic place to meet up with friends is its vibrant, lively atmosphere combined with its spacious outdoor seating area where guests can enjoy freshly prepared Mexican dishes. Highlights include their homemade tortillas, the iconic tacos al pastor, and a menu boasting a diversity of meats like barbacoa, lengua, and alambre tacos. The food truck's dedication to quality shines through its use of fresh, locally sourced ingredients, giving every dish a robust and authentic Mexican flavor. Whether you're grabbing breakfast tacos or sampling nachos and quesadillas for lunch or late-night comfort food, Rosita's offers an inviting and casual environment perfect for socializing and indulging in genuine Mexican cuisine.

Love the breakfast tacos here. Once a week after doing a 9 mile loop around lady bird lake, I stop at Rosita’s for breakfast tacos and they have not disappointed yet. Both their red and green salsas are creamy which I’m not a big fan of but they’re good.

The food was amazing, we’re from SATX and this definitely reminded me of the tacos we have back home. The people were nice and everything is reasonably priced, the lengua and al pastor were amazing. They have ice cold beer, Jarritos, and sweets. Salsa was good too! We relaxed on their swinging benches afterwards.

This place is genuinely good for food. Although it is a bit odd ordering your food while the cashier can watch you tip or not as they pass the tablet to confirm payment. BESIDES THAT, the food is amazing. The pastor is on point. I ordered the campechana nachos and did not regret it. The green salsa they serve on the side elevates the flavor. Indoors is a bit stuffy, but they have a BIG patio with seating. They even have a food truck outside serving the same food if it's too crowded inside. Will be coming back for sure!
